Of the 412 customers enrolled, 61 (14.8%) closed or downgraded their accounts before the pilot concluded, concentrated in the first eight weeks. Exit interviews conducted by the Dunmere branch team point to fee transparency and onboarding friction as the dominant factors, rather than competitor pricing. Retention stabilised after the revised welcome process was introduced in month three. Branch managers should review the confidential direction set out immediately below.

confidential, kagup-bafog: Fraaxax Group is in early talks to buy Soroxox Group for about $343.8 million. The Olidor launch date is June 14, and nothing goes to the press before then. Legal wants the Aldmirek Logistics term sheet signed before July 23.

Postmortem timeline — Vexhall schema registry outage (weekly sync)

14:02 — Registry pod OOM-killed after a consumer uploaded a 40MB event schema.
14:05 — Producers began failing validation; event writes queued.
14:11 — On-call scaled memory, added a 1MB schema size cap.
14:19 — Backlog drained, producers green.
Follow-up: enforce size limits at the gateway, not the registry. Full writeup in the Vexhall wiki. The build that shipped the cap is noted below.

trace token, kahog-tajeg: htk6_97d963

**Mgmt Meeting Minutes — Retiring the Brightline Range**

Quick recap for sales leads at Fenholt Supplies: we agreed to retire the Brightline fixture range by year-end. Remaining stock moves to clearance pricing next month, and accounts on standing orders get migrated to the Lumetta range. Trade-in incentives were approved in principle. The confidential note on next steps sits just below.

board note of bajof-bajeg: The pricing group signed off on a budget of $13.4 million for Project Sildor. The renewal with Lamixek Holdings closes at $48.9 million a year, 49 percent above the last contract.